Synopsis Irradiation of seeds of Adams and Hawkeye soybeans with X‐rays and thermal neutrons significantly increased the genetic variability for yield, plant height, maturity, and seed size. The estimates of genetic variance in the irradiation treatments averaged five times as large as those in the controls, and the predicted genetic gains from selection indicated that an advance could be made within each population for all characters except plant height.
